- Account Issues: Problems with logging in, password resets, or account verification are frequent concerns. If you're locked out of your account or can't remember your password, customer service can guide you through the recovery process.
- Subscription Problems: Questions about billing, canceling subscriptions, or upgrading your account are also common. Understanding the terms of your subscription and how to manage it is crucial, and support can clarify any confusion.
- Data Accuracy: Sometimes, the financial data displayed might seem incorrect. Whether it's stock prices, historical data, or financial statements, reporting discrepancies is important for maintaining the platform's accuracy.
- Technical Glitches: Issues like website errors, app crashes, or problems with specific features can disrupt your experience. Reporting these technical issues helps the Yahoo Finance team identify and fix bugs.
- Feature Inquiries: Understanding how to use specific features, like portfolio tracking or advanced charting tools, can be tricky. Customer service can provide tutorials and explanations to help you make the most of the platform's capabilities.
- General Navigation: New users often need help navigating the platform and finding the information they need. Support can offer guidance on how to use the site effectively and locate specific data.

- Be Clear and Specific: When you reach out, clearly explain your issue. Provide as much detail as possible, including any error messages, screenshots, or relevant account information. The more information you give, the easier it will be for the support team to understand your problem and find a solution.
- Check the Help Resources First: Before contacting customer service, take some time to browse the Yahoo Help Central and Community Forums. You might find that your question has already been answered, saving you time and effort.
- Be Polite and Patient: Remember that the customer service representatives are there to help you. Be polite and patient, even if you're frustrated. A positive attitude can go a long way in getting your issue resolved quickly.
- Keep a Record of Your Interactions: Keep track of your conversations with customer service, including dates, times, and the names of the representatives you spoke with. This can be helpful if you need to follow up on your issue later.
- Follow Up If Necessary: If you don't hear back from customer service within a reasonable amount of time, don't hesitate to follow up. Sometimes, inquiries can get lost in the shuffle, so a gentle reminder can help get your issue back on track.

How to Contact Yahoo Finance Customer Service
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: how do you actually get in touch with Yahoo Finance customer service? While Yahoo doesn't have a direct phone line for Yahoo Finance specifically, there are several other ways to get the help you need. Knowing these options can save you a lot of time and frustration.
